How Can Educational Policies Foster Equity and Inclusion in Diverse Classrooms?

Challenges in Educational Policies

  1. Unfair Funding:
    Many school funding policies don't give enough money to schools that really need it. This makes the gap between rich and poor schools even bigger.

  2. Cultural Insensitivity:
    Some policies ignore the different backgrounds of students. This can make kids from minority groups feel left out and unimportant.

  3. Insufficient Training for Teachers:
    Teachers often don’t get enough training to help them include all students in their lessons.


Possible Solutions

  1. Fair Funding Models:
    We need to create rules that ensure all schools get the money they need, so no school is left behind.

  2. Cultural Understanding Training:
    Teachers should go through training that helps them understand and appreciate different cultures. This way, they can create a more welcoming environment for all students.

  3. Inclusive Curriculum Development:
    Schools should develop lessons that include different viewpoints and stories. This means making sure that all students can see themselves represented in what they learn.
